Economics B.B.A.

An 18-hour B.B.A. major or a 12-hour B.B.A. minor (beyond the 6 hours of Economics required in the university core) is available. This major is preparation for careers in banking, global commerce, government services, corporate business, and education/teaching.

Beginning with the Fall 2008 semester, the following 4 goals will be established for all Economic majors before they graduate: 1) the student will demonstrate an understanding of and the difference between fiscal policy and monetary policy; 2) the student will demonstrate an understanding of the existence of market externalities and their ramifications; 3) the student will demonstrate an understanding of the formulation and purpose of linear regression models; 4) the student will demonstrate an understanding of the causes of currency fluctuations and the results thereof.
